Martino seeks supervisor post

Martino
Arthur Martino has announced his candidacy for a two-year term as Allegheny Township Supervisor. Having been appointed to this role in 2024, Martino said he is eager to continue this vital work for the next two years.
A resident of Allegheny Township, Martino said he is committed to ensuring the township remains financially stable, and said he has supported a fiscally sound township and has helped keep taxes stable for more than 20 years.
Martino said his background in safety and regulatory compliance provides him with the insights necessary to navigate township operations effectively. He prioritizes public safety, financial responsibility and responsive leadership and said his earlier experience as an Allegheny Township auditor has given him knowledge of financial mechanisms that are essential to the township’s success.
